I have a feeling the Deanna story might go the same direction as the Phillip Spaulding story on GL when he believed that Beth was still alive. He was thought of as crazy, but as it turned out.. Beth was really alive.

I actually think Deanna is truly struggling with her grief and mental health, and is masking that with this tough exterior. It's realistic and a true portrayal of someone dealing with mental health issues and not wanting to be seen as weak.

Lastly, Ashley Abbott was a force of nature and tough as nails in her early days on YR before it was revealed that it was just a front for her masking her own insecurities and mental health issues.
